S o, what's going on at Camp Fuller? I'm glad you asked.
Lots of Liquid Sunshine!
Check-out Camp Fuller’s Facebook page to see pictures of the Flood of 2010! Fortunately, damage was minimal. Camp Fuller Road washed out and was impassable for half a day, but has been repaired. The council fire area became a temporary pond, but it is beginning to dry out.

I t is with great sadness that the passing of Ted Ressler needs to be reported this week. Ted was Fuller's director from 1961 - 1968 was was instrumental in helping to shape the camp into what it is today. Even though he will not be able to attend, Ted will still be inducted into the Legends of Camp Fuller Hall of Fame on July 24, 2010. His spirit and the fond memories of those he came in contact with will create a lasting memory.

C amp Fuller’s Annual Campaign has the end in sight too. Our Financial Support drive will end on April 1st. Our goal is to raise $82,000 so that we can make Camp affordable and available to all parents and their children, regardless of their ability to pay.
